Documents: The Domestic Email Collection Program The NSA 'Killed' In 2011 Was Actually Just Offshored:
New documents obtained by Charlie Savage of the New York Times (as the result of a FOIA lawsuit) show that the NSA may have killed off its bulk collection of US persons' emails back in 2011, but it quickly found another way to obtain these -- a way that circumvented restrictions on domestic collections.
